INSTALLING AND SECURING YOUR SMART BOARD V280 INTERACTIVE 
WHITEBOARD
Environmental Requirements
Before installing your SMART Board V280 interactive whiteboard, review the following 
environmental requirements.
Environmental 
Requirement
Parameter
Operating temperature 41°F to 95°F (5°C to 35°C)
Storage temperature
-40°F to 120°F (-40°C to 50°C)
Humidity
5–80% relative humidity, non-condensing
Water and fluid 
resistance
• Intended for indoor use
• Don’t pour or spray liquids directly on the electronic 
components
Dust
• Moderate dust
• Designed for pollution degree 1 (P1) as per EN61558-1, 
which is defined as “No pollution or only dry 
non-conductive pollution.” Refer to page 45 for detailed 
instructions on periodically cleaning your interactive 
whiteboard.
Electrostatic discharge 
(ESD)
• Designed to withstand electrostatic shock
• EN61000-4-2 severity level 4 for direct and indirect ESD
• No malfunction or damage up to 15kV (both polarities) 
with a 330 ohm, 150 pF probe (air discharge)
• Unmated connectors meet no malfunction or damage 
up to 8kV for direct (contact) discharge
Conducted and 
radiated emissions
EN55022/CISPR 22, Class B 
Flammability rating
• Electronics and connectors: UL 94-V0
• USB enclosure (hub plastics): UL94-HB
• USB 2.0 cable: UL VW-1/CSA FT4
Quality assembly
• USB cable: IPC/WHMA-A-620 Class 2 workmanship 
standards for Requirements & Acceptance for Cable & 
Wire Harness
• Digital cameras: IPC-A-610 standards for Acceptability 
of Electronic Assemblies, to Class 2 specifications 
(Dedicated Service Electronic Parts)
